Collin Morikawa bobbled Wanamaker Trophy after winning PGA Championship
Collin Morikawa reacts as the lid falls off the Wanamaker Trophy as he lifts the trophy to celebrate winning the 2020 PGA Championship golf tournament at TPC Harding Park. Kyle Terada-USA TODAY Sports

Colin Morikawa had a smooth day on Sunday and a great week in San Francisco, so his only misplay came after he was done with golf.

The 23-year-old golfer bobbled the Wanamaker Trophy he was given after winning the PGA Championship, resulting in the top of the trophy coming off. Take a look:

You can’t blame him for proudly shaking the trophy, but he might have gone a little more lightly had he realized the top would come off.

If all goes well, Morikawa will have other chances to handle the trophy more smoothly in the future.

Morikawa shot a 64 on the final day to finish the tournament 13-under. He now has three PGA Tour wins — two of which have come within the last month. The Cal product had one other awkward moment after winning the major.
